I have since read that about a year ago, the Program By Design /
Racket group of academics(*) posted an online draft of their
Java-based sequel to 'How to Design Programs'. As far as I can tell,
the new book has a couple of working titles : 'How to Design Classes'
and 'How to Design Components'.

I haven't read it, but the premise of the book seems to tie in with
Frank Shearer's comment about objects being higher order functions
that close over variables. The preface, which includes a one-line
quote from Alan Kay, may prove interesting to the readers of this
thread.
